As nouns the difference between completion and compliance

is that completion is the act or state of being or making something complete; conclusion, accomplishment while compliance is an act of complying.

    compliance

    English

    Noun

  • An act of complying.
  • (uncountable) The state of being compliant.
  • (uncountable) The tendency of conforming with or agreeing to the wishes of others.
  • A measure of the extension or displacement of a loaded structure; its flexibility
  • (medicine) The accuracy with which a patient follows an agreed treatment plan
  • (uncountable, business) the department of a business that ensures all government regulations are complied with
